When households are selecting a hygiene innovation with your help, there are several interrelated and variable factors that they should take into account. A few of these factors are made a decision by the geographical location you are operating in and you will certainly not be able to affect these, although it is essential that you take them right into account.

Your geographical location will certainly affect factors such as: Climatic problems: for instance, in highland locations with heavy annual rainfall, latrines ought to be created as though protects against flooding. Topography and geological formations: the depth of the aquifer, kind of rock and the permeability of the soil; sandy dirts, for instance, are much more absorptive than clay dirts.


The number of people, their characteristics and mindsets will certainly all need to be thought about. : Cultural reputation: social and social beliefs, and the values and practices of a community, are vital considerations for families when choosing a sanitation modern technology. Cost: the selection of modern technology will depend on the capability and desire to pay; the price should be fairly low for lots of people to be able to afford it.


Access: youngsters, senior individuals and individuals with handicaps might require unique factor to consider to make sure the picked center is conveniently obtainable to them without pain or trouble. It is necessary to take into consideration the regional context and whether regional resources can be utilized - liquid waste removal. This consists of: Schedule of sources and framework: the visibility of human abilities, building materials and other resources may make one technology better than one more


Power resource and pit draining demands: in backwoods where a pit emptying service is not offered, families will certainly need to depend on conventional latrines. Demand for reuse of the waste: centers that eventually assist families to recycle and utilize waste, such as composting and biogas reactors, are important factors to consider too.

In basic, the technology we select need to give a total obstacle to the fluid waste in order to safeguard the family members's health, while serving in regards to price (i.e. installation, operation and maintenance expenses) and be socially and culturally sound. In Research study Session 19, you have found out that: Hygiene can be defined as the ways whereby human excreta, along with community wastewaters, are gathered and gotten rid of to make sure that they do not trigger any type of injury to the area.


Fluid waste can be classified as human waste, sullage, industrial waste or overflow. Different techniques of waste administration relate to these various categories. Human waste can be included utilizing wet or dry sanitation systems. Wet or water-carriage techniques need simple access to a water system and are not generally ideal in country locations.

Septic tanks offer partial, anaerobic treatment of liquid waste. Anaerobic biogas reactors convert liquid wastes into a sludge and biogas with anaerobic processes.
